| 1 added class/operation | |||
|
D | AddRecipeController::newSimpleAction() added | |
| A | ↘ | D | AddRecipeController::newAction() got worse |
| 3 added classes/operations | |||
|
A | RatingService::postRatingAction() added | |
|
A | RatingService::setEntityManager() added | |
|
A | RatingService::setRequest() added | |
| 1 added class/operation | |||
|
A | RecipeService::beforeReturn() added | |
| B | ↗ | A | ApiController::postRecipesAction() improved |
| 3 added classes/operations | |||
|
D | RecipeIngredientRepository::getIngredients() added | |
|
A | RecipeIngredientRepository added | |
|
A | Recipe::setIngredientsCustom() added | |
| A | ↘ | D | IngredientRepository::getFiltered() got worse |
| 5 added classes/operations | |||
|
A | RecipeService::expandIngredients() added | |
|
A | RecipeService::getRecipesByIngredients() added | |
|
A | RecipeService::__construct() added | |
|
A | RecipeService added | |
|
A | RecipeRepository::getByIngredients() added | |
| A | ↘ | B | ApiController::postRecipesAction() got worse |
| 1 added class/operation | |||
|
A | HomePageController::anyAction() added | |
| 1 added class/operation | |||
|
A | RatingService::addRatingByIpAll() added | |
| D | ↗ | A | IngredientType::buildForm() improved |
| 1 added class/operation | |||
|
A | ScrapeService::nodeValid() added | |
| C | ↗ | B | ScrapeService::scrapeInstructions() improved |
| B | ↗ | A | ScrapeService::scrapeIngredients() improved |
| A | AddRecipeControllerTest::testNew() removed | ||
| A | AddRecipeControllerTest removed |
| 3 added classes/operations | |||
|
B | RatingService::addRatingByIp() added | |
|
A | RatingService::__construct() added | |
|
A | RatingService added | |
| C | ↗ | A | Recipe::getIngredientsNormalized() improved |
| 1 added class/operation | |||
|
A | Recipe::isReadOnly() added | |
| Image URL | |
| Markdown | |
| Textile | |
| RDOC | |
| AsciiDoc |